Should jeans be tight at first? This question often arises when trying on a new pair of jeans, and the answer is that jeans should feel snug initially, as they tend to stretch over time. Understanding the right fit can ensure comfort and longevity in your denim wear.
Why Should Jeans Be Tight at First?
When buying jeans, a snug fit is crucial because denim naturally stretches with wear. This means that jeans that fit perfectly in the store may become too loose after a few wears. Here are some reasons why a tighter fit is beneficial:
- Stretch Factor: Denim fabric, especially those with elastane, will loosen over time.
- Longevity: A snug fit ensures that jeans maintain their shape longer.
- Style: Tight jeans often offer a more flattering silhouette initially.
How to Determine the Right Fit for Jeans?
Choosing the right fit involves understanding your body type and the style of jeans. Here are some tips to help you find the perfect pair:
- Waist Fit: Jeans should fit comfortably around the waist without needing a belt.
- Hip and Thigh Fit: Look for a snug fit in the hips and thighs, as this area tends to stretch the most.
- Length: Consider the length, especially if you plan to wear them with different types of footwear.
Types of Jeans and Their Fit
Different styles of jeans offer various fits, and knowing these can help you make an informed decision:
| Style | Fit Characteristics | Best For |
|---|---|---|
| Skinny Jeans | Snug from waist to ankle | Slim or athletic builds |
| Straight Jeans | Even fit from hips to hem | All body types |
| Bootcut Jeans | Snug through thighs, slight flare at hem | Balancing wider hips |
| Relaxed Jeans | Loose fit throughout | Comfort and casual wear |
How to Break In New Jeans
Breaking in new jeans can enhance comfort and fit. Here are some methods:
- Wear Them Often: Regular wear helps jeans conform to your body shape.
- Wash Sparingly: Frequent washing can cause jeans to lose shape and color.
- Stretching Exercises: Perform movements like squats or lunges to help stretch the fabric naturally.

How tight should jeans be when you buy them?
Jeans should feel snug but not uncomfortably tight. You should be able to move freely without pinching or discomfort. The waistband should sit comfortably around your waist without gaping.
Do all jeans stretch over time?
Most jeans, especially those with a blend of elastane or spandex, will stretch with wear. However, 100% cotton jeans may stretch less and require more breaking in.
Can tight jeans be harmful?
Wearing excessively tight jeans can lead to discomfort and potential health issues, such as restricted circulation or nerve compression. It’s important to find a balance between style and comfort.
How can I shrink jeans that have become too loose?
To shrink jeans, wash them in hot water and dry them on high heat. Be cautious, as this can also affect the color and fabric integrity over time.
What are the signs of a poor jeans fit?
Signs of a poor fit include excessive gaping at the waist, bunching at the knees, or being unable to fasten the waistband comfortably. Always try different styles and sizes to find the best fit.
